Sorry! JavaScript is disabled in your browser. To get the best user experience on our website you should enable it.

Tech blogging

3 years ago

ID: #386186

Business Description

Looking for free blog submission website in order to improve visibility of your website? The best place to submit free blogs is Techblogging.com.au, a premium blog submission site.

No Review.

Please login / register to add your review.